Are black cloves worse than cigarettes?

Exposure to tar, nicotine, and carbon monoxide is higher from clove cigarettes than from regular American cigarettes. In smoking machine tests, clove cigarettes averaged over twice as much tar, nicotine, and carbon monoxide delivery as moderate tar-containing American cigarettes (3).

Are clove cigarettes illegal?

In September 2009, the Food and medicine Administration (FDA) banned the sale of candy-flavoured, fruit-flavoured and clove-flavoured cigarettes. In response to the FDA ban, Kretek International developed and marketed the Djarum clove cigar to replace their popular clove cigarettes.

Is there tobacco in clove cigarettes?

Kreteks—sometimes referred to as clove cigarettes—are imported from Indonesia and typically contain a mixture of tobacco, cloves, and other additives. Bidis and kreteks have higher concentrations of nicotine, tar, and carbon monoxide than conventional cigarettes sold in the United States.

Why do clove cigarettes crackle?

The smell is accompanied by a soft snap and crackle as smokers puff on kreteks – cigarettes laced with cloves. … Kreteks take their name from the faint crackling sound made when volatile clove oil is released from the spice within while the cigarette burns.

How much nicotine is in a clove of cigarettes?

The nicotine content of a popular clove cigarette (Djarum Special) filler averaged 7.4 mg; conventional cigarettes contained 13.0 mg. However, smoke yields from standardized machine-smoking analysis indicated it delivered more nicotine, carbon monoxide (CO), and tar than conventional cigarettes.

Why are clove cigarettes illegal?

Background: Following the passage of the Family Smoking Prevention and Tobacco Control Act in 2009, flavoured cigarettes, including clove cigarettes, were banned based on the rationale that such cigarettes appealed to youth. However, the ban on characterising flavours was not extended to cigars.

What happens if you smoke cloves?

When you smoke a clove, it deadens sensation of the throat, so you’re taking deeper drags, and you don’t stop when it would or should hurt. The American Journal of Nursing said clove smokers have reported coughing up blood, nosebleeds, frequent upper respiratory infections, severe chest pains, nausea, and vomiting.
